Nigerian artistes, Rema, Davido, Tems, Odumodublvck, and others were among the big winners at the 17th edition of the Headies Awards, held at the Landmark Event Centre in Victoria Island on Sunday, April 27.

This year’s edition, themed “Back to Base”, marked a significant return to Nigerian soil after recent editions were held abroad. The event focused on celebrating the outstanding achievements in Nigerian music that would have been honored in 2024, a year in which the awards were not held.

Rema took home the Afrobeats Album of the Year award for his genre-defying sophomore album, HEIS. Tems’ hit single soul-stirring “Burning” won Best Recording of the Year in a competitive category, besting tracks like Seyi Vibez’s “Different Pattern”, Burna Boy’s “Higher”, Ayra Starr & Giveon’s “Last Heartbreak Song”, and Sarz & Lojay’s “Billions”.

Afro-Pop superstar, Davido, also emerged as the Best Digital Artiste of the Year, while Zerry DL claimed the Rookie of the Year award. The most anticipated award of the night, the Next Rated category, was won by rapper and singer, Odumodublvck.

The Headies, an annual award recognising exceptional achievements in the Nigerian music industry, was hosted by Nigerian actress and media personality, Nancy Isime, alongside influencer, Enioluwa Adeoluwa. The evening was filled with electrifying performances from Odumodublvck, Kcee, Flavour, Nasboi, and many others.

The ceremony was broadcast live on HipTV, reaching viewers across Nigeria, as it celebrated the vibrant and diverse talents of the Nigerian music scene.
